ASSIGNMENT: Evidence of the Big Bang (10 points)

Instructions: 

For this assignment watch the video and answer the questions below. Feel free to skip to 5:00 minutes in the video. That is when they start talking about the Big Bang. Be sure to provide complete and well-thought out answers to the questions to get full credit. 



Questions: 

1. Describe at least two pieces of evidence that support the Big Bang Theory. Explain how each piece of evidence provides support: 

2. What is a theory? Why is the Big Bang Theory a theory, rather than a law or a hypothesis? 

3. What are the two most abundant elements in the universe? Why is this abundance so important in accepting the Big Bang Theory?
